Power Seat Systems Components
Seat Front Vertical, Seat Rear Vertical, and Seat Horizontal POSiTion Sensors and Motors

Circuit Description

The memory seat module (MSM) supplies a 5 volt reference voltage to all of the seat position sensors from connector C1 cavity 13 (GRY).

Conditions for Setting the DTC

The 5-volt feed voltage falls out of the range of 4.6-5.2 volts.

Action Taken When the DTC Sets

The MSM does not allow any memory recall function. Only manual seat movement is allowed. Only one seat motor moves at a time.

Conditions for Clearing the DTC

The 5-volt feed voltage is within a valid operating range during the last monitoring cycle.

Test Description

The numbers below refer to the step numbers on the diagnostic table.

  1. This step tests for an open or short to ground in CKT 788 (GRY).

  2. This step tests for a short to battery positive voltage (B+) in CKT 788 (GRY).
